Transaction 3967e50bd9214443cd03dd8a43e035710564a93bc7797b1543a2bc3af450eab8
1 Input
1 Output
-
3967e50bd9214443cd03dd8a43e035710564a93bc7797b1543a2bc3af450eab8:0
- value
- 1705480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84c9d326ff6d64e3d111d3efb6e91de9dd5079d9 OP_EQUAL
- address
- 3Do8tu7QbYHvi7ru87ZK4ycXXBzhEuRDaV